If you are getting a body shop to do the painting on your interior, then you will get a better look than the stick on kind. s for maintenence, you have to stick with soap and water, and maybe even wax it.
There are 3 types of stick-ons with sub categories. Wood, plastic, metal. Of course there is wood looking plastic. And metal looking plastic. The ones by torasport for example are thick acrylic which is held on by super duty 3m tape. Thats some strong tape. Take a look at their site and see what the different colors look like on assorted things.
When the dash kit is moulded and covers the edges so none of the original seeps through, the in my opinion it doesn't matter what its made of. It looks good and is durable. $200 is for the assorted moulds that theyhave to create and inject to get the piece for your car. THink about it there are 500 cars that they do ieach with 10 parts.
